The hexadecimal color code #DAB593 corresponds to the code RGB( 218, 181, 147 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,85 level), green (at 0,71 level) and blue (at 0,58 level). Its brightness is 71% and its saturation is 48%. It is composed of red at 39%, green at 33% and blue at 26%.
